Volunteer availability based fault tolerant scheduling mechanism in desktop grid computing environment

被引:0
|
作者
Choi, SJ [1 ]
Baik, MS [1 ]
Hwang, CS [1 ]
Gil, JM [1 ]
Yu, HC [1 ]
机构
[1] Korea Univ, Dept Comp Sci & Engn, Seoul 136701, South Korea
关键词
D O I
暂无
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Fault tolerance is essential to the further development of desktop grid computing system in order to guarantee continuous and reliable execution of tasks in spite of failures. In a desktop grid computing environment, volunteers are often susceptible to volunteer autonomy failures such as volatility failure and interference failure in the middle of execution of tasks because a desktop grid computing maximally respects autonomy of volunteers. The failures result in an independent livelock problem (i.e. the delay and blocking of the entire execution of a job). Therefore, the failures should be considered in a scheduling mechanism. In this paper in order to tolerate volunteer autonomy failures, we propose a new fault tolerant scheduling mechanism. First, we specify a volunteer autonomy failures and an independent livelock problem. Then, we propose a volunteer availability which reflects the degree of volunteer autonomy failures. Finally, we propose a fault tolerant scheduling mechanism based on volunteer availability (which is called VAFTSM).
引用
收藏
页码:366 / 371
页数:6
相关论文
共 50 条
  • [31] A Review on Resource Availability Prediction Methods in Volunteer Grid Computing
    Rubab, Saddaf
    Hassan, Mohd. Fadzil B.
    Mahmood, Ahmad Kamil B.
    Shah, Nasir Mehmood
    2014 IEEE INTERNATIONAL CONFERENCE ON CONTROL SYSTEM COMPUTING AND ENGINEERING, 2014, : 478 - 483
  • [32] Fault-Tolerant Scheduling Mechanism for Dynamic Edge Computing Scenarios Based on Graph Reinforcement Learning
    Zhang, Yuze
    Xia, Geming
    Yu, Chaodong
    Li, Hongcheng
    Li, Hongfeng
    SENSORS, 2024, 24 (21)
  • [33] Adaptive workflow scheduling in grid computing based on dynamic resource availability
    Garg, Ritu
    Singh, Awadhesh Kumar
    ENGINEERING SCIENCE AND TECHNOLOGY-AN INTERNATIONAL JOURNAL-JESTECH, 2015, 18 (02): : 256 - 269
  • [34] Recovery Mutual Scheduling: A Decentralized Approach for Fault Recovery Mechanism in the Grid Computing
    Babu, M. H. Anand
    Palanichelvam, B.
    Suganya, R.
    ADVANCEMENTS IN AUTOMATION AND CONTROL TECHNOLOGIES, 2014, 573 : 571 - 575
  • [35] DCCWOA: A multi-heuristic fault tolerant scheduling technique for cloud computing environment
    Javid Ali Liakath
    Pradeep Krishnadoss
    Gobalakrishnan Natesan
    Peer-to-Peer Networking and Applications, 2023, 16 : 785 - 802
  • [36] DCCWOA: A multi-heuristic fault tolerant scheduling technique for cloud computing environment
    Liakath, Javid Ali
    Krishnadoss, Pradeep
    Natesan, Gobalakrishnan
    PEER-TO-PEER NETWORKING AND APPLICATIONS, 2023, 16 (02) : 785 - 802
  • [37] Automated Fault Tolerant System for Control Computational Power in Desktop Grid
    Kumar, Rajesh
    Surender
    2015 IEEE INTERNATIONAL ADVANCE COMPUTING CONFERENCE (IACC), 2015, : 818 - 821
  • [38] A decentralized and fault-tolerant Desktop Grid system for distributed applications
    Abbes, Heithem
    Cerin, Christophe
    Jemni, Mohamed
    CONCURRENCY AND COMPUTATION-PRACTICE & EXPERIENCE, 2010, 22 (03): : 261 - 277
  • [39] Towards optimal fault tolerant scheduling in computational grid
    Imran, Muhammad
    Niaz, Iftikhar Azim
    Haider, Sajjad
    Hussain, Naveed
    Ansari, M. A.
    THIRD INTERNATIONAL CONFERENCE ON EMERGING TECHNOLOGIES 2007, PROCEEDINGS, 2007, : 154 - +
  • [40] Research and Improvement of Resource Scheduling Mechanism in Alchemi Desktop Grid
    Cao, CaiFeng
    Jiang, DeDong
    ADVANCES IN MULTIMEDIA, SOFTWARE ENGINEERING AND COMPUTING, VOL 1, 2011, 128 : 497 - 502